The rapid jab ends once the attack button is released. Prior to ''[[Smash 4]]'', this causes the character to simply stop attacking – however, from ''Smash 4'' onwards, rapid jabs have a final hit known as a '''rapid jab finisher''' that is designed to launch opponents away, and is used once the attack button is released. Since no new button input is made to activate this final hit, it is not its own stage of the natural combo.

Characters like [[Kirby]], [[Fox]], and [[Sheik]] are known for possessing rapid jabs. [[Meta Knight]] is unique for having ''only'' a rapid jab, and no standard jab beforehand. Instead, his [[tilt attack]] is a standard three-hit jab.
